How to Define Curly Hair

Well-defined curls are typically hydrated, bouncy, and less prone to frizz. Curl definition isn't about changing your natural texture; it's about enhancing the curl pattern you already have.

 

To improve curl definition:

 

  • Use a sulfate-free shampoo that cleanses without stripping moisture.
  • Follow with a hydrating conditioner to improve softness and manageability.
  • Apply curl-enhancing, long-lasting, intensive moisturizer leave-in cream on damp hair.
  • Avoid rubbing hair aggressively with a towel.
  • Use a microfiber towel or cotton T-shirt to gently remove excess water.
  • Allow curls to air dry or use a diffuser attachment on low heat.

 

The key to defined curls is maintaining moisture while minimizing friction and unnecessary manipulation.

Care Routines and Products for Curly Hair

Curly hair tends to be naturally drier than straight hair because natural oils have a harder time traveling down the hair shaft. This makes hydration one of the most important aspects of curly hair care.

 

Prioritize Moisture

 

Hydrating shampoos, conditioners, and hair masks for curly hair help replenish moisture and support curl elasticity. Regular deep-conditioning treatments can help improve softness and reduce dryness.

 

Avoid Overwashing

 

Frequent washing can strip away essential oils, leaving curls dry and frizzy. Depending on your scalp type and lifestyle, washing two to three times a week may be sufficient.

 

Use Leave-In Products

 

Leave-in conditioners and curl creams help maintain hydration between washes while improving curl definition and reducing frizz.

 

Protect Your Curls Overnight

 

Sleeping on a satin pillowcase or loosely tying your hair in a pineapple hairstyle can help preserve curl patterns and reduce friction while you sleep.

Haircuts for Curly Hair

Curly hair offers incredible versatility when it comes to haircuts. The right cut can enhance natural volume, improve shape, and make styling easier.


Cropped Curly Hairstyles


Short, cropped curls can be stylish, low-maintenance, and easy to manage. This haircut highlights the natural texture of the hair while minimizing styling time.


Curly Pixie Cut


A curly pixie cut combines sophistication with personality. This style works particularly well for those with fine to medium curl patterns and can be customized with or without bangs.


Afro-Inspired Shapes


For tighter curls and coils, afro-inspired cuts celebrate natural volume and texture. From a shorter silhouette to a fuller rounded shape, this style allows curls to take center stage.


Curly Bob


A curly bob is one of the most flattering options for medium-length hair. Whether it falls at the chin or shoulders, a well-structured bob enhances movement and bounce while maintaining a polished appearance.


Curly Shag


The curly shag has become increasingly popular thanks to its effortless, lived-in appearance. Layers help distribute volume evenly while creating movement and texture throughout the hair.

Curly Hairstyles for Every Occasion

One of the greatest advantages of curly hair is its versatility. Whether you're attending a wedding, heading to work, or enjoying a casual day out, there is a curly hairstyle to suit every occasion.


Wear Your Curls Naturally


Healthy, well-defined curls are a statement in themselves. Allowing your curls to fall naturally showcases their texture, volume, and individuality.


Twisted Styles


Twisting small sections of hair and pinning them back creates an elegant look without compromising your natural curl pattern. This style works particularly well for festive celebrations and family gatherings.


Curly Buns


A curly bun combines sophistication with practicality. Whether you prefer a high topknot or a low bun, this hairstyle keeps hair secure while highlighting your curls.


Half-Up Hairstyles


A half-up look provides the perfect balance between wearing your curls down and creating structure. It is an excellent choice for both casual and formal occasions.
